摘要
Two isostructural 3D microporous metal-organic frameworks, which show a 6-connected (4(8).6(6).8) self-penetrating net, contain two different narrow-sized channels functionalized by amino groups on the pore surface. In particular, both of them show exceptional stability and a high selectivity for CO2 over N-2 at 298 K.
